The biggest problem we have seen is with the new fob where the customer does not realize you need to push the LOCK button on the fob first and then the 2X button twice.

I have the factory installed remore start in my limited. I have been able to start the Explorer from at least 175' away while it was parked in the garage. Haven't tried it from a further distance yet.
One thing to remember is that this particular remote start system will not work if two remote vehicle starts have already been attempted within the hour. The vehicle will flash the lights but will not start. That might explain why some who are remote start testing find that their Ex won't start.
